In this picture is pollen that got stuck to the ground because of juice or water. Pollen has been flying around because plants and flowers are blooming and they are ready to fertilize. Pollen is like a tiny grain inside id a seed plant which usually looks like dust. Each pollen grain is different, they very in shape and structure. Pollen is synthesized in the anther, in seed-bearing plants which is transported to another plant (flower) by wind water or insects (bees/birds) to the pistol where fertilization occurs.
